We examine the recent suggestion by Falk and Schramm that heavy neutrinos with the right mass and the right radiative lifetime may cause the supernova explosion. It is shown that if leptons and quarks are composite and their excited states exist, excited neutrinos are shown to satisfy the desired mass-lifetime relation. The mass range of such excited neutrinos between order of eV and about 10 MeV is disallowed by cosmological constraints.
